"New York Jazz Vocals" by Jill Seifers is a captivating journey through the world of vocal jazz, showcasing the artist's evolution from her early days to her current status as a celebrated jazz vocalist. This expansive collection, released on April 10, 2017, under BlueMusicGroup.com, features an impressive 50 tracks that span a generous 3 hours and 19 minutes. Seifers, known for her animated and bubbly stage presence, brings a unique energy to classic jazz standards and contemporary pieces alike.
Collaborating with renowned musicians Eeppi Ursin and Mika Pohjola, as well as fellow vocalist Rigmor Gustafsson, Seifers delivers a rich and diverse musical experience. The album includes beloved jazz standards such as "I'll Be Around," "I Say a Little Prayer," and "When Sunny Gets Blue," alongside lesser-known gems like "Lov Ära och Pris" and "Sakta VI Gå Genom Stan." Seifers' versatility shines through in her interpretations, ranging from sultry ballads like "Angel Eyes" to upbeat numbers like "Night Fever."
Originally from Portland, OR, Seifers' journey in the jazz world is marked by her initial nervousness and eventual triumph, making this album a testament to her growth and dedication.
